Managing Google Cloud's Apigee API Platform for Hybrid Cloud

Learn how to install and manage Google Cloud's Apigee API Platform in a hybrid cloud. This course uses lectures and a lab to show you how to install, manage, and scale your Apigee hybrid API Platform.

Ce que vous allez apprendre

  • Identify the purpose and value of Apigee API Platform.
  • Describe basic concepts and capabilities of Google Cloud, Kubernetes, REST, and Anthos.
  • Discuss Apigee API Platform architecture and recommended practices for topology design.
  • Explain Apigee terminology and logical organizational structures.
  • Install Apigee hybrid on Google Kubernetes Engine.
  • Discuss infrastructure security, user access management, data storage, and encryption practices used in Apigee hybrid.
  • Manage environments in Apigee hybrid.
  • Discuss capacity planning and scale runtime components in the hybrid runtime plane.
  • Describe the upgrade and rollback process used for the Apigee hybrid installation.
  • Troubleshoot and monitor the hybrid runtime plane components using logs, metrics, and analytics.
